Andover Community Trusts fourth permanently
affordable home
Cheever Circle
Andover Community Trust completed it fourth permanently affordable home on Cheever Circle in August 2008. Andover Community Trust had signed a purchase and sale agreement with the owner of the 10,000 square foot lot and received the support of the Andover Housing Partnership Committee and the Andover Board of Selectmen to build the modest three bedroom home. Although the SRA zoning calls for 15,000 square foot lots, the abutting homes, built before the current zoning, are also on 10,000 square foot lots. The home is appropriate to the neighborhood, and was sold to an income eligible household with a ground lease and permanent affordability restrictions, approved by both Andover Town Counsel and the Massachusetts Department of Housing and Community Development.
In August of 2008, the owner and her two school aged children moved into their beautiful new home!
